On Monday 08 May 2017 05:18 PM, Lankhorst, Maarten wrote:
> Mahesh Kumar schreef op ma 08-05-2017 om 17:18 [+0530]:
>> Fail the flip if no FB is present but plane_state is set as visible.
>> Above is not a valid combination so instead of continue fail the
>> flip.
> Why is this patch necessary? drm_atomic_plane_check handles this.
Ideally we should never get such combination here. But current WM code 
checks for this situation and even if it's true it proceeds further. 
This patch just corrects the WM code flow decision.
I also think some of these checks are redundant here.
